  Re: Issues with a Few Parts on the Tracker
 
(...) Basically the CMDLINE staement specifies a default color for the part. This is useful if the part only came in one color. I far as I know, no LDraw programs actually use this Meta command. -Orion (21 years ago, 11-Apr-04, to lugnet.cad.dat.parts)
